Piastri says McLaren hasn't 'underestimated' Red Bull's all-around strength

It's widely believed in the F1 paddock that Red Bull no longer has the fastest car on the grid. Instead, McLaren's MCL38 is now the quickest. The Woking-based team, however, are yet to maximise their 2024 season. Of course, McLaren secured their first race victory this season in Miami, the first since Daniel Ricciardo's 2021 Monza triumph. Despite this, they've lost out to Red Bull on multiple occasions. Most recently, In Spain, where Lando Norris finished just two seconds behind Verstappen on an alternate strategy after losing the lead at the first corner.
